#80f6c4 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#80f6c4 is composed of 50.2% red, 96.5% green and 76.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 48% cyan, 0% magenta, 20.3% yellow and 3.5% black. It has a hue angle of 154.6 degrees, a saturation of 86.8% and a lightness of 73.3%. #80f6c4 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#01ed89. Closest websafe color is: #99ffcc.

Shades and Tints of #80f6c4

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000101 is the darkest color, while #eefef7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#80f6c4

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#babcbb is the less saturated color, while #7bfbc5 is the most saturated one.
